U1.16 — The Concept of the Marketing Mix

Overview

The marketing mix is the set of marketing decisions a business makes to attract customers and achieve its marketing goals.

It started as the 4PsProduct, Price, Place, Promotion.

Many modern businesses (especially service businesses) use the extended marketing mix, which adds three more Ps to create the 7Ps.

7Ps extended marketing mix

The 7Ps (Extended Marketing Mix)

The first four are the original 4Ps. The last three are added because services rely heavily on staff, systems, and customer experience.

📦Product

Original 4P

What the business sells. This includes features, quality, design, branding and packaging.

  • What problem does it solve for customers?
  • What makes it better or different?

💲Price

Original 4P

What customers pay and how the price is set.

  • Budget vs premium pricing
  • Discounts, bundles, memberships

📍Place

Original 4P

Where and how customers buy. It’s about convenience and access.

  • In-store vs online
  • Location, distribution and delivery

📣Promotion

Original 4P

How the business communicates to attract customers and persuade them to buy.

  • Advertising, social media, sponsorships
  • Sales promotions, PR, influencer posts

🧑‍🤝‍🧑People

Extended 7P

The staff and service quality. People can make or break the customer experience.

  • Training, attitude, expertise
  • Customer service and communication

⚙️Process

Extended 7P

How the service is delivered from start to finish.

  • Waiting times, booking, checkout
  • Consistency and reliability

🏷️Physical Evidence

Extended 7P

The “proof” of quality customers can see or experience.

  • Venue appearance, signage and ambience
  • Website quality, reviews, uniforms
